Eli has feelings for Owen, confirmed by original author.


This isn't new news, but I recently had a conversation with someone who suggested this was ambiguous. And while it may have been in the films, the author's intent was clearly shown in the sequel novella 'Let the old dreams die" which shows Owen and Eli in a photo in 2008 with Owen not aged a day.

Of course, you can take the films how you want to, art allows that, but the original authors intent was they they had feelings for each other.

I think you meant Abby, not Eli. Eli is from Let the Right One In.

Hard to say for sure since everyone seems to have a different take on it, but the director did point out he took direct inspiration from the film Klute for the scene where Abby smiles at Owen in the arcade while he isn't looking. He mentioned that was a way to show real feelings for another character.
